Chapter 43 - The Cost of Staying in the Top 20

The locker room reeked of sweat, turf, and silence.

Nobody dared break it.

The scoreline still burned in their minds: 2–1. Their first league match of the season. Their first loss.

Some players sat with their heads lowered, jerseys clinging to their skin. Others rubbed their faces with towels, as if they could wipe away the sting of defeat. The echo of the opposing crowd's cheers still rang in Dante's ears.

For him, it was different. His first real game for Eternal Era—called in from Team B, thrust into the spotlight, with the crowd screaming for a miracle. And he had delivered—he had scored. For a moment, the stadium had roared his name.

But it hadn't been enough.

Now he sat with his hoodie pulled up over his damp hair, staring at the floor, the glow of adrenaline fading into a heavy knot of frustration.

Then the door opened.

Jason entered.
